Descrizione

This annual collection of essays showcases a diverse array of scholarly work, addressing significant themes and figures from the Renaissance period. Each contribution brings a unique perspective, delving into the intricate literary landscape shaped by notable writers such as Shakespeare, Donne, and Middleton. With topics ranging from the nuanced craft of poetry to the socio-political contexts of the time, the volume presents a thorough examination of the era’s rich literary heritage.

The anthology not only highlights the artistic achievements of these pivotal authors but also invites readers to engage with the historical underpinnings of their works. Scholars of different backgrounds contribute to this compilation, enriching the discourse surrounding Renaissance literature and offering fresh insights. This fusion of research reflects the ongoing relevance of Renaissance thought in contemporary literary studies, making it an essential resource for both seasoned academics and new enthusiasts eager to explore this captivating period.
